The vineyards of Alsace play an important role in the history of Alsace. Viticulture was first developed by the Romans, then revived by the Merovingians and Carolingians. By the Middle Ages, Alsatian wines were already among the most prestigious in Europe. The 16th century marked the heyday of Alsatian viticulture, a prosperous period that would come to an end with the Thirty Years’ War.
At the end of World War I, the Alsace wine region regained its prestige. Winegrowers decided to focus on traditional grape varieties and committed to a policy of quality. Starting in 1945, production had to adhere to strict rules governing both cultivation and winemaking. The Alsace AOC (Appellation d’Origine Contrôlée) was recognized in 1962. Today, it accounts for more than 70% of the region’s wines.
In Alsace, it is the grape varieties that give the wines their names, not the region. The grape varieties used for Alsace white wines (90% of production) are Riesling, Gewürztraminer, Sylvaner, Pinot Blanc, and Pinot Gris. Alsace red wines are made from Pinot Noir. Covering an area of 15,000 hectares, the Alsace vineyard stretches 120 km long, often less than 1 km wide. The vineyard benefits from a semi-continental climate, with cold winters and hot, dry summers. Thanks to the Vosges mountain range to the west, the vineyard is protected from wind and rain.
